General Information
Title: Lady, your eye my love enforced
Composer: Thomas Weelkes
Number of voices: 5vv Voicing: SSATB
Genre: Secular, Madrigal
Language: English
Instruments: a cappella

Original text and translations
English text
Lady, your eye my love enforced,
and your proud look my heart divorced:
Fa la la la:
That now I laugh and now I cry,
and thus I sing before I die:
Fa la la la.
